Transaction 59924404564733887411674015f718641283bf2bedba55975d39384639e9be18

3 Input
2 Outputs
  • 59924404564733887411674015f718641283bf2bedba55975d39384639e9be18:0
  • value  52510422
    address  3PtarjCHqTFq5RqjFE1hPUiLkAWWzsbKrL
  • 59924404564733887411674015f718641283bf2bedba55975d39384639e9be18:1
  • value  14920000
    address  1PVJHrnYu5RJ6BQtS9Grw9uagTncQvcrxm